What is 4/5 divided by 2/3

4/5 divided by 2/3 =
switch the 2nd fraction around;
4/5 x 3/2

4 x 3 = 12
5 x 2 = 10

Answer: 12/10 or 6/5 (simplified) or 1.2 as a decimal
